1. From Virtua to Vanar: a proactive transformation of 'de-NFTing'

Vanar's predecessor is Virtua / Terra Virtua (TVK), one of the more mature NFT and metaverse projects in the early days of Web3:

Core direction: 3D NFT, immersive experience, VR showroom

Target audience: artists, games, film IPs, brands

Emphasizing NFT's displayable, interactive, and usable aspects rather than pure image assets

This history is not a burden, but rather laid the foundation for Vanar's later judgment:

When NFTs, the metaverse, and games truly land, the biggest bottleneck lies not in content but in whether 'intelligence and state' can exist long-term.

As the NFT craze recedes, the team made a key choice:

No longer building platforms around content, but sinking to the infrastructure layer to solve the problem of 'on-chain intelligence unable to run long-term'.

TVK final 1:1 swap for $VANRY, Vanar officially transforms into an AI + Web3 infrastructure project.

Five, technical architecture disassembly

🔹 Vanar Chain (L1 base layer)

Modular design

High throughput, low fees (Gas < $0.01)

Carbon neutrality (Google renewable energy support)

🔹 Neutron

Responsible for on-chain data proof and execution

Ensure the credibility and verifiability of AI-related computations

🔹 Kayon

Provide logic, trust, and contextual memory

Is the core component of 'continuous intelligence'

🔹 Coming soon

Axon, Flows: for AI workflow, agent collaboration, and complex logic orchestration

The overall is not a 'fast chain + AI concept', but a complete system built around the intelligent lifecycle.
